Evaluation of an Acute Stroke Patient with Flat Detector CT Prior to
Mechanical Thrombectomy
Author(s): Nadine Amelung, Daniel Behme, Michael Knauth and Marios Nikos Psychogios
Nadine Amelung, Daniel Behme, Michael Knauth and Marios Nikos Psychogios
Flat panel detectors have revolutionized tomographic imaging in the angio suite. Recent developments in hardware and software have improved soft tissue resolution and acquisition time even further, enabling soft-tissue and perfusion imaging within the angio suite. The so called “one-stop-shop” stroke imaging with flat panel detector computed tomography (FDCT) will significantly improve door to groin times and probably have an impact on patient outcome. In the presented case a patient underwent multidetector CT (MDCT) to exclude hemorrhage, then MDCT angiography (MDCTA) to identify the occluded vessel, and MDCT perfusion (MDCTP) for penumbra imaging. Patient’s symptoms significantly improved during transport to the angiography suite.
